Why Replace Your Electric Motorbike Battery?
Signs that your electric motorbike battery may need replacement include reduced range, longer charging times, or visible physical damage. If the battery no longer holds a charge as it used to, or if performance declines significantly, it might be time to consider a replacement. A good electric motorbike battery should last for hundreds of cycles, meaning several years, depending on usage and maintenance. Familiarize yourself with your manufacturer's recommended maintenance schedule and follow it to ensure optimal performance.

Carefully follow the manufacturer's safety guidelines and take necessary precautions to prevent electrical shock and other hazards. Wear protective gear and ensure the battery is properly secured to prevent damage or injury.
Choose a battery with a compatible voltage, capacity, and chemistry. Verify the specifications and consult with the manufacturer or a qualified mechanic if unsure. Opt for batteries with a reputable brand name and excellent customer reviews.
